Jessie's Chicken Tetrazini


> 2 1/2 c. cooked spagetti (I use whole wheat)
> 3 Tbsp butter (I use olive oil)
> 6 Tbsp chopped onion (I use a whole onion)
> 1 can sliced mushrooms or 1 lb. fresh
> 1 1/2 tsp celery salt
> 1/2 tsp salt
> 1/2 tsp pepper
> 1 tsp poultry seasoning
> 1 can evaporated milk (lg)
> 1 can cream of chicken or mushroom soup
> 2 c. cooked and cut chicken
> 2 1/2 c. chedder (I use less about 1 1/2 c.)
> 1/2 c. parm (I use about 3/4 c.)
optional: 1 10 oz. cooked package frozen aspargus cuts or brocolli

Saute onion in butter, add mushrooms then spices. Add milk and soup. Then add 3/4 of the chedder and 1/2 parm. Stir in spagetti. Place in 9X13. Top with the rest of cheese. Cook 350 for 45 minutes.
